Palma Holding and Ibdar Bank sign new lease with Falcon Aviation

This is the third Shari’ah compliant leasing transaction executed by the joint venture as part of its strategy to serve the aviation sector. The first two transactions were executed with Ethiopian Airlines and RwandAir, where a total of five aircraft were acquired and leased.
“The purchase of three additional Q400 NextGen aircraft underlines a commitment by Palma and Ibdar to airlines in the Middle East and Africa and reflects a strong acquisition strategy that has resulted in the addition of eight aircraft to our portfolio over the last nine months. It also underscores our joint ability to structure financing and lease agreements with leading players in the market. With other transactions approaching completion, we look forward to making further announcements regarding the addition of more aircraft to our expanding portfolio in the near future,” said Moulay Omar Alaoui, president of Palma Holding.
